Latest Patents
One of her latest patents is a method for generating diversity in antibody-producing cell lines. This invention involves a systematic approach to prepare a cell line capable of directed constitutive hypermutation of a specific nucleic acid region. The steps include screening a clonal cell population for V gene diversity, isolating cells that display this diversity, and selecting a cell where the rate of V gene mutation exceeds that of other gene mutations. This innovative method could enhance the efficiency of antibody production for various medical applications.
